[quote name='Muffin_Man']I did search on this, but the only post I found was over a year old. so I'll ask to see if anyone else has come up with a better solution. Has anyone come up with a fool-proof way to remove the spine stickers from the GS game boxes? Mine put them right on the paper game insert, not on the plastic. I tried using a hair dryer, which worked OK, but left quite a bit of residue. I tried using just a little goo gone on one of the paper inserts and it made the ink on the insert run just a little.
Just a little of-topic, but any help is appreciated.[/quote]
My method only works if the stickers aren't ancient. Peel the sticker from the corner and make sure you grab as much of the sticker as you can. Peel a little and move your grip on the sticker forward. Little by little. Take your time and don't just rush it. If the sticker starts ruining the spine, I just grab my pocket knife and slide it under the sticker. Make sure it's very well sharpened or it won't do crap. And be careful with the knife. I've ripped off all the art where the sticker was once.
